.calendar-detail-container[data-v-3da015ca]{width:100%;min-height:600px;display:flex;flex-direction:column;justify-content:space-between}.calendar-detail-container .day[data-v-3da015ca]{margin-left:auto;margin-right:auto;display:flex;align-items:center;justify-content:center;border-radius:16px;--un-bg-opacity:1;background-color:rgb(255 59 57 / var(--un-bg-opacity));color:var(--text-color-white);font-weight:500;font-size:32px;width:72px;height:72px}.calendar-detail-container .slider-calendar[data-v-3da015ca]{margin-top:8px;width:100%;font-weight:500}.calendar-detail-container .slider-calendar .date[data-v-3da015ca]{margin-bottom:4px;display:flex;align-items:center;justify-content:space-between}.calendar-detail-container .slider-calendar .weeks[data-v-3da015ca]{display:grid;width:100%;flex-wrap:wrap;align-items:center;justify-content:center;grid-template-columns:repeat(7,1fr)}.calendar-detail-container .slider-calendar .weeks .week-number[data-v-3da015ca]{height:24px;display:flex;align-items:center;justify-content:center;font-size:12px}.calendar-detail-container .slider-calendar .days-container[data-v-3da015ca]{display:grid;width:100%;flex-wrap:wrap;grid-template-columns:repeat(1,1fr)}.calendar-detail-container .slider-calendar .days-container .days[data-v-3da015ca]{display:grid;height:24px;align-items:center;text-align:center;font-size:12px;color:var(--text-color-2);grid-template-columns:repeat(7,1fr)}.calendar-detail-container .slider-calendar .days-container .days .day-number[data-v-3da015ca]{line-height:24px;width:24px;height:24px}.calendar-detail-container .slider-calendar .days-container .days .cur-day[data-v-3da015ca]{border-radius:50%;background-color:var(--danger-color);text-align:center;color:var(--text-color-white)!important}.calendar-modal .ant-modal-content{padding:0}.left[data-v-21e0f781]{display:flex;border-radius:12px;background-color:var(--bg-color-4);padding-left:10px;backdrop-filter:saturate(180%) blur(40px)}.main-calendar[data-v-21e0f781]{--fc-border-color: rgba(221, 221, 221, 60%);border-radius:12px}.main-calendar[data-v-21e0f781] .fc-scrollgrid .fc-col-header{width:822px!important}.main-calendar[data-v-21e0f781] .fc-scrollgrid .fc-scrollgrid-section-liquid>td{border-bottom-right-radius:12px}.main-calendar[data-v-21e0f781] .fc-scrollgrid .fc-scroller-harness{border-bottom-right-radius:12px}.main-calendar[data-v-21e0f781] .fc-scrollgrid .fc-col-header-cell-cushion{color:var(--text-color-1);font-weight:400}.main-calendar[data-v-21e0f781] .fc-scrollgrid .fc-daygrid-body-balanced{width:822px!important}.main-calendar[data-v-21e0f781] .fc-daygrid-day-frame:has(.is-week){background-color:var(--bg-page)}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table{width:822px!important}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today{background:none!important}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today .fc-daygrid-day-number-diy{width:24px;height:20px;border-radius:50%;--un-bg-opacity:1;background-color:rgb(255 59 57 / var(--un-bg-opacity));text-align:center;color:var(--text-color-white)}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today .fc-daygrid-day-frame:has(.is-week){background:#ff3b39}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today .fc-daygrid-day-frame:has(.is-week) .fc-daygrid-day-top-left .fc-daygrid-day-top-left-date,.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today .fc-daygrid-day-frame:has(.is-week) .fc-daygrid-day-top-left .lunar-day-title{color:var(--text-color-white)}.main-calendar[data-v-21e0f781] .fc-scrollgrid-sync-table .fc-day-today .fc-daygrid-day-frame .fc-daygrid-day-top-left{color:var(--text-color-white)}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top{justify-content:center}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top .fc-daygrid-day-number{width:100%;padding-top:0;padding-bottom:0;color:var(--text-color-3)}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left{position:relative;text-align:center}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.fc-daygrid-day-top-left-date{display:flex;align-items:center;justify-content:space-between}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.fc-daygrid-day-number-diy{width:100%;text-align:right;font-size:14px;color:var(--text-color-1);font-weight:500}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.lunar-day-title{display:inline-block;width:100%;text-align:left;font-size:12px;color:var(--text-color-1);font-weight:500;letter-spacing:.3px}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.lunar-start{border-bottom:1px solid #ff3b39}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.china-holiday-day{position:absolute;width:100%;border-radius:2px;--un-bg-opacity:1;background-color:rgb(255 204 217 / var(--un-bg-opacity));text-align:center;font-size:12px;color:var(--text-color-3);font-weight:500}.main-calendar[data-v-21e0f781] .fc-daygrid-day-top-left .china-holiday-work{position:absolute;width:100%;border-radius:2px;background-color:var(--text-color-place);text-align:center;font-size:12px;color:var(--text-color-3);font-weight:500}.main-calendar[data-v-21e0f781] .fc-daygrid-day-events .fc-daygrid-event{margin:2px;background-color:#f2f3f3;border-radius:2px}
